Como Lidar Com Problema Da Regiao Critica Sincronizacao Sistemas De Computacao

Como Lidar com Problema da Região Crítica - Sincronização - SISTEMAS DE COMPUTAÇÃO

00:00 Introdução
0:32 O Problema da Região Crítica
13:09 Operações Atômicas
14:24 Solução de Peterson
18:22 Hardware de Sincronização
21:04 Hardware de Sincronização: Test and Set
24:15 Hardware de Sincronização: Compare and Swap
27:34 test_and_set com Espera Limitada
31:56 Semáforos
37:37 Semáforos - Produtor/Consumidor
45:45 Semáforos - Produtor/Consumidor: Múltiplos Processos
52:32 Semáforos - Implementação
53:17 Monitor
56:23 Implementação de Monitor usando Semáforo
58:36 Conclusão

Acompanhe a Playlist de Sistemas de Computação aqui:
youtube.com/playlist?list=PLBw9d_OueVJTEpM8sOKJ7S8jleQPCSQs3

Acompanhe a Playlist Programação de Computadores I - Python aqui:
youtube.com/playlist?list=PLBw9d_OueVJSE7kbIAnjq2AgrnncO2SwM

Esta série de vídeos faz parte da ementa da disciplina de Sistemas de Computação, onde será introduzido os conceitos básicos sobre Arquitetura de Computadores e Sistemas Operacionais para melhor manipulação de dados em sistemas de computação. É um requisito conhecer a linguagem de programação C para abordar conceitos de Sistemas Operacionais. Conteúdo da disciplina:
1 - Tecnologias Computacionais;
2 - Desempenho;
3 - Bits/Operações;
4 - Operações Aritméticas;
5 - Representação de Ponto Flutuante;
6 - Modelo de Máquina;
7 - Instruções de Linguagem de Máquina;
8 - Procedimentos;
9 - Dados Estruturados;
10 - Tecnologia de Memória;
11 - Memória Cache;
12 - Processos;
13 - Escalonamento de Processos;
14 - Threads;
15 - Sincronização;
16 - Gerenciamento de Memória;
17 - Memória Virtual

Gostou do vídeo? Clique em gostei e se inscreva no canal.
Se inscreva no canal AQUI: bit.ly/2oqevTy

Muito obrigado por assistirem o vídeo.
Até o próximo vídeo!

#SistemasDeComputação #SistemasOperacionais #ProgramacaoDeComputadores #LeandroSantiago

  • Como Lidar com Problema da Região Crítica - Sincronização - SISTEMAS DE COMPUTAÇÃO ( Download)
  • Me Salva Sistemas Operacionais: Exemplo e Definição do Problema da Região Crítica ( Download)
  • Me Salva Sistemas Operacionais: Sincronização em Software - Solução de Peterson ( Download)
  • Me Salva Sistemas Operacionais: O que é Semáforo ( Download)
  • Sistemas Operacionais - Aula 6 - Processos: Condições de corrida, Região crítica, Exclusão mútua ( Download)
  • A PIOR TRAIÇÃO feat GRACYANNE BARBOSA e HUGO #shorts ( Download)
  • Áudio do monitor não está saindo (SOLUÇÃO) ( Download)
  • Sistemas Operacionais - Aula 11 - Processos: Problema leitores escritores, Escalonamento ( Download)
  • Uma dúvida constante! #martina #familia #pais ( Download)
  • Expectativa x realidade. E você lindona, Opção 1 ou 2 ( Download)
  • Definição de Threads e Diferença entre Thread de Usuário e de Kernel - SISTEMAS DE COMPUTAÇÃO ( Download)
  • Aceleradores de Domínio Específicos e as Tecnologias Computacionias - SISTEMAS DE COMPUTAÇÃO ( Download)
  • Me dá muito medo esse som de Silent Hill! ( Download)
  • Não conta pro Google, mas você pode ter a sua PRÓPRIA NUVEM! - Deploy Nextcloud Linux Server ( Download)
  • Programação Concorrente ( Download)